S219 KFR is a 1998 Volkswagen Golf in Black with a 1,600c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 16 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 56.3%.

Across all 1998 Volkswagen Golf models, the average MOT pass rate is 66.1% with a typical mileage of 100,017 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.

The most common reason a Volkswagen Golf f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 700,382 recorded failures. If you're considering buying S219 KFR,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.

The Volkswagen Golf typically stays on UK roads for around 37 years. At 28 years old, this Volkswagen Golf is well into its expected lifespan but still has years ahead.
